Rejected petition Dismiss Oliver Letwin from his Ministerial Positions
In light of memos he wrote when an advisor to Thatcher, we call on Oliver Letwin to resign as Chancellor of the Duchy of Lancaster and Minister of State for Government Policy. They give rise to a reasonable apprehension of racial bias, making him unfit to hold executive authority in modern Britain.
More details
His comments not only portray a stereotyping of black people as involved in the "disco and drug trade", but also imply that the riots were to be attributed to the colour of the residents of Tottenham, which is deeply racist. ("Lower-class, unemployed white people lived for years in appalling slums without a breakdown of public order on anything like the present scale".)
